Best Popcorn Time forks for iOS without a computer
Finding a reliable Popcorn Time-style app for an iPhone or iPad is harder than finding a desktop build. Apple’s App Store rules exclude apps designed to locate or stream unauthorised copyrighted material, so most iOS options appear as browser services, unofficial IPA files, or temporary sideloaded builds. Many disappear quickly when certificates expire or hosting changes.
For Australians, the practical choice depends on more than a fork’s catalogue. NBN performance varies between suburbs and regional areas, mobile data can become expensive during a long film, and Australian copyright rules still apply when content arrives through a torrent swarm. The safest approach is to assess each option for privacy, stability, device compatibility, and access to content you are legally entitled to watch.
What counts as an iOS Popcorn Time fork
A true fork is a project built from, or heavily influenced by, the source code and design of an earlier Popcorn Time release. Some forks preserve the familiar catalogue, magnet-link handling, subtitles, and torrent streaming features. Others are simply websites using a similar interface, with no downloadable iPhone application behind them.
For iOS users, the difference matters. An App Store listing that uses the Popcorn Time name may be unrelated to the original project, while a website may work in Safari without offering a genuine iOS client. An IPA file can be a real application, but installing it usually requires sideloading, a signing service, or a developer account. Those methods can stop working without warning.
Popcorn Time Online is generally associated with a browser-first experience, making it more suitable for people who do not have a Mac or Windows computer. Butter and Popcorn Time Community Edition are better known as desktop-oriented projects, so their presence on an iPhone should be treated carefully. An “iOS fork” advertised through a random download page may be an old build, a repackaged app, or a prompt to install unwanted profiles.
Forks that are realistic without a computer
Browser-based versions are the most accessible option for an iPhone or iPad. They avoid the need for a laptop, and Safari can often play ordinary HTML5 video while supporting AirPlay. The trade-off is that browser services may have fewer settings, weaker subtitle controls, and less predictable playback than a maintained native application.
Unofficial iOS builds are another category, although they are rarely dependable for long. Some use enterprise certificates; others rely on services that install an app through a configuration profile. Apple can revoke the certificate, leaving the application unable to open. A service that asks for an Apple ID password, disables security settings, or installs several unrelated apps should be avoided.
The most credible choice is usually the fork with transparent source code, a visible release history, clear privacy information, and an active community. A polished landing page is not enough. Check whether the project explains who maintains it, when the latest iOS version was published, and whether the app still supports current iOS releases. A fork with no recent activity is unlikely to cope well with changes in Safari, certificate rules, or media formats.
Checking an option before installing it
Start with the application’s origin. Look for a recognised project page rather than a shortened link shared in a comment or a pop-up. A trustworthy page should explain the installation method, permissions, supported devices, and known limitations. It should not promise every new cinema release in perfect quality or insist that you turn off iOS security controls.
Permissions provide another useful filter. A streaming client should not need access to contacts, messages, banking information, or a complete photo library. A request to install a device-management profile deserves particular caution, especially when the profile comes from an unfamiliar company. Remove profiles you no longer need through iPhone settings and avoid entering payment details into unofficial download pages.
Security software cannot make a questionable fork safe. Torrents connect a device or service to other peers, and the file or stream may come from an unknown source. A VPN can conceal an IP address from other peers and reduce tracking by an internet provider, but it does not verify the content, prevent malware in a downloaded file, or turn unauthorised access into lawful viewing.
Installing and using a fork on an iPhone
For a browser-based service, the process is relatively simple: use a current version of Safari, check that the site uses HTTPS, and avoid accepting notifications or calendar subscriptions unless they are genuinely needed. If the player offers an Add to Home Screen option, treat it as a shortcut rather than proof that a native app has been installed.

Before following any installation step, confirm that it applies to iOS and has not been copied from an old Android or desktop tutorial.
If an IPA is involved, the lack of a computer becomes the central limitation. Some signing services install apps directly from Safari, but their certificates can be revoked and their business practices vary. AltStore-style methods commonly need a computer for initial setup, while direct enterprise installation may be withdrawn at any time. A service that claims permanent installation for every iPhone model should be regarded with scepticism.
Keep iOS updated and remove an app if it starts opening unexpected pages, draining the battery, or asking for new permissions. Do not install a mobile device-management profile simply to make a video player work. A short-lived fork is not worth compromising the security of an iPhone used for Medicare, banking, work email, or two-factor authentication.
Playback, subtitles, and Australian connections
Performance depends on both the fork and the connection to the torrent swarm. A fast NBN plan can still buffer if there are few peers, while a modest connection may play smoothly when a popular title has many healthy sources. In apartments around Sydney or Melbourne, evening congestion can affect playback; in regional Queensland, Western Australia, or South Australia, the available fixed-line technology may be the bigger limitation.
Mobile streaming deserves extra care. A single high-definition film can use several gigabytes, which can consume a prepaid allowance or trigger excess charges. Downloading over public Wi-Fi also creates privacy risks, particularly on networks in airports, hotels, university campuses, or busy cafés. If a legitimate service offers an offline mode, it is usually a more predictable option for a long train trip or a weekend away.
Subtitles and casting vary between forks. Safari video may support AirPlay to an Apple TV, while Chromecast compatibility can depend on whether the player exposes a cast button or simply mirrors the browser tab. An iPad may handle subtitles better than an older iPhone, but neither device will fix a subtitle file that is out of sync or encoded in an unsupported format.
Check the home network before blaming the application. Restarting the router, moving closer to a Wi-Fi access point, and switching from crowded 2.4 GHz Wi-Fi to a stable 5 GHz network can help. For regional households using fixed wireless or satellite broadband, pausing cloud backups and large game downloads may make a noticeable difference during an evening stream.
Australian legal and privacy considerations
Australian copyright law applies whether a film is accessed through a website, a native app, or a torrent-based fork. A torrent client generally uploads pieces to other users while receiving a video, so the activity can involve communication and reproduction of copyrighted material rather than simple private viewing. Rights holders have also used court processes and site-blocking measures against services connected with unauthorised distribution.
A VPN is best understood as a privacy tool, not legal protection. Choose a provider with a clear logging policy, modern protocols, and servers that perform well from Australia. Be wary of free VPNs that fund operations through aggressive advertising or the sale of usage information. A VPN also cannot protect an account if a user reuses passwords or installs an untrusted configuration profile.
The catalogue itself can raise concerns. A title may be available through a licensed Australian platform such as ABC iview, SBS On Demand, Kanopy, Stan, Binge, or a rental store, even when a fork displays it first. Availability changes because of distribution agreements, classification decisions, and regional rights. Checking JustWatch Australia or the relevant broadcaster can identify a lawful source before using an unfamiliar stream.
Families should consider age ratings and content controls as well. A fork may show titles without the parental tools found in Apple TV, Netflix, or other regulated services. That matters on a shared iPad used by children, particularly when autoplay leads from a familiar programme to material with a very different rating. Keep personal details out of unofficial services and use legitimate platforms whenever they provide the programme you want.
